Career Role (Marine Hydrothermal Vent Expertise) Description
Marine Geologist/Geophysicist Investigates the geological processes around hydrothermal vents, mapping the seafloor and analyzing mineral deposits. High demand for expertise in underwater technologies.
Marine Biologist/Ecologist Studies the unique ecosystems thriving around hydrothermal vents, focusing on the biodiversity and adaptations of extremophile organisms. Strong background in marine biology and environmental science is crucial.
Oceanographic Engineer Designs and operates specialized equipment for hydrothermal vent research, including remotely operated vehicles (ROVs) and autonomous underwater vehicles (AUVs). Requires robust engineering and technological skills.
Marine Chemist Analyzes the chemical composition of hydrothermal vent fluids and their impact on the surrounding environment. Expertise in geochemical analysis is essential.
Data Scientist (Marine Hydrothermal Vent Data Analysis) Processes and interprets large datasets from hydrothermal vent research, using advanced statistical methods and machine learning techniques. Strong analytical and programming skills are required.
